Identifying Wasp Nests



To recognize wasp nests, very carefully observe your surroundings and look for distinct physical features that suggest their visibility. One essential sign is the existence of wasps flying in and out of a details area. Take notice of areas such as eaves, rooflines, and tree branches, where wasps typically build their nests.

Look for frameworks constructed from paper-like material, which is a typical building product for wasp nests. These frameworks can differ in size, varying from tiny, golf ball-sized nests to bigger, basketball-sized nests.

Safe and Efficient Wasp Nest Removal



When handling the presence of a wasp nest, it is essential to recognize exactly how to securely and efficiently remove it. Below are do it yourself pest control or call approaches to assist you with safe wasp nest elimination:

- ** Safety Clothing **: Constantly wear safety garments, such as long sleeves, pants, gloves, and a beekeeping veil, to secure on your own from possible stings.

- ** Evening Removal **: Wasps are less energetic during the night, so it's finest to get rid of the nest after sunset when they're less likely to be hostile.

- ** Making use of Pesticide **: Use an insecticide specifically made for wasp nest removal. Splash it straight onto the nest, covering the entire surface area.

Preventing Wasp Nests in the Future



To avoid future wasp nests, take aggressive steps to eliminate attractants around your property. Start by securing any type of fractures or openings in your walls, home windows, and doors to prevent wasps from getting in and developing nests.

Keep your trash bin snugly secured and routinely deal with food waste to avoid drawing in wasps. Additionally, remove any kind of potential nesting websites by routinely inspecting and preserving your residential or commercial property. Trim tree branches, shrubs, and bushes that might supply a suitable spot for wasps to develop their nests.

Stay clear of leaving standing water or uncovered food and drinks outside, as this can additionally bring in wasps. By taking these positive actions, you can substantially reduce the likelihood of future wasp nests and enjoy a wasp-free setting.
